Brand conscious
I wanted to buy a packet of Marlboro, but the shop guy right in front of my hotel looked very apprehensive and told only Wills brands are available. Within a few minutes a gentleman standing next to the shop left in his bike, the scene changed immediately.
"Sir, which brand you want...Marlboro, 555, Dunhill or B&H," he asked me enthusiastically. Stunned by the sudden attitude change, I asked reasons for it. "Sir, that man standing next to you was from Wills company and I was not supposed to sell any other brand than it. Now that he is not there I can give you the brand of your choice," he said.

So much for brand loyalty!
